Azizulhasni through to keirin semis at London worlds


UCI World Track Cycling Championships - London, Britain - 6/3/2016 - (L-R) Maximilian Levy of Germany, Jason Kenny of Britain, Azizulhasni Awang of Malaysia and Rafal Sarnecki of Poland compete in their men's keirin first round heat. REUTERS/Andrew Winning

*Update: Azizulhasni qualifies for the final after finishing second in his heat in the semi-finals.

PETALING JAYA: Azizulhasni Awang went through the hard way to reach the men’s keirin semi-finals at the Track Cycling World Championships at Lee Valley Velopark in London.
